Terms & Conditions
1. This contract is between Leoda Studios (hereinafter known as the Photographer) and the Clients (hereinafter known as the Couple).
2. It is mutually agreed that the following terms of agreement form an integral part of this contract and that no variation or modification of this contract shall be effective unless agreed by both parties in writing.
3. This contract for wedding photography services is effective from the date it is signed by the couple.
4. The photographer will only deal with matters concerning the contract or booking with the couple.
5. The photographer agrees to be in attendance on the date shown and to provide the couple with the photographic package shown above.
6. If the photographer is unable to attend the wedding due to illness or any other unforeseen circumstances preventing his attendance a suitable replacement photographer will be provided by the photographer.
7. The photographer agrees that the above price will not be subject to any subsequent rises within the Leoda Studios pricing structure.
8. The couple agree to pay a 20% deposit to secure their desired date and understand that in any event of cancellation this deposit is 100% refund will be done if informed prior 14 days of actual wedding date. 50% refund will be done if informed prior 7-14 days of actual wedding date. No refund is applicable if cancellation done within 7 days of actual wedding date
9. The couple agree to pay the full remaining balance of the photography package purchased at least on the wedding date.
10. The photographer agrees that every effort will be made to provide the highest quality photographic services in the prevailing conditions.
11. The photographer will discuss a shot list with the couple prior to the wedding to outline the normal shooting plan at every wedding. The photographer will also ask the couple to provide a list of family photographs they request to have taken on the wedding. If no list is provided the photographer will capture as many family shots as possible in the time frame given but cannot be held accountable by the couple for family shots missed due to the couple not providing a list regardless of how simple.
12. In the unlikely event of total or part photographic failure, equipment failure, hard drive failure, memory card failure, theft, death, injury or illness, accident or other unforeseen circumstances beyond the photographers control, the photographers liability shall be limited to a full refund of all moneys paid and the photographer shall not be responsible for other consequential damages, emotional or otherwise.
13. The photographer retains the copyright of all images taken and may be used for advertising, competitions or promotional purposes at the photographers discretion. The photographer also retains the right to restrict the couple from giving the images to any third party for advertising without permission from the photographer.
14. No one other than the photographer is permitted to edit any photographs provided by the photographer unless the photographer grants permission.
15. The couple will receive the best images from the wedding, selected by the photographer and edited to a professional standard, the couple will not receive every photograph taken on the day and the couple will not receive RAW files or negatives.
16. In booking the photographer, you have taken into consideration the photographers style and are granting artistic license in all aspects relating to the photography of your wedding.
17. For pre-wedding and post wedding outdoor shoots Travel and food expenses charges have to be provide to the photographer excluding the Package rate.
18. The photographer will give suggestions for location photographs if requested by the couple but will not be liable for the guarantee of the use of the location nor the conditions of the location including any charges
19. Any directions issued to clients, their guests or employees during a photographic shoot are deemed to be at said persons own risk. The photographer cannot be held responsible for any personal accidents during a photographic shoot.
20. The photographer is the only authorised and official photographer for your wedding day. The earliest the photographer will work on any wedding day is two hours before the ceremony and the latest shall be 9.00pm. A hot meal for the photographer must be provided if evening coverage is requested.
21.The client(s) hereby allow(s) the photographer to display any photograph covered by this contract and to generally promote the business in advertising, brochures, magazine articles, websites, sample albums etc.
22. The copyright Designs and Patents Acts assign the copyright of the images to the photographer.
23. Couple will be given the maximum timeline of 1 month from the wedding date to decide on the post wedding shot date and location. Also the couple has to give the notice date, a week prior to the actual date of post wedding shoot.
